Clinton Duo Faces Scrutiny in Epstein Investigation as House Panel Demands Testimony

Washington D.C. – A contentious battle is brewing between former President Bill Clinton, former Secretary of State Hillary Clinton, and House Oversight Committee Chairman James Comer as the panel intensifies its investigation into the activities of the late Jeffrey Epstein. The committee is seeking direct testimony from both Clintons regarding their connections to Epstein, a convicted sex offender whose case continues to generate significant public and political interest.

The Epstein Investigation: A Deep Dive

The ongoing investigation, led by Representative Comer, centers on scrutinizing the network of individuals associated with Jeffrey Epstein and the potential misuse of influence. Epstein’s crimes, which included sex trafficking of minors, came to light again in recent years, prompting renewed calls for accountability and a thorough examination of those who may have been connected to him. The House Oversight Committee believes that testimony from the Clintons is crucial to understanding the full scope of Epstein’s activities and any potential implications for national security or public trust.

The demand for testimony follows years of speculation and scrutiny surrounding Bill Clinton’s travels aboard Epstein’s private jet, known as the “Lolita Express.” While Clinton has acknowledged flying on the aircraft, he has consistently maintained that he was unaware of Epstein’s criminal behavior. Hillary Clinton’s involvement has been less direct, but the committee is reportedly interested in exploring her knowledge of Epstein’s activities during her time as Secretary of State.

The Clintons have, through representatives, expressed reservations about appearing before the committee, citing concerns about politically motivated attacks and the potential for the proceedings to be used for partisan gain. This standoff raises fundamental questions about the balance of power between Congress and former high-ranking officials, and the extent to which the legislative branch can compel testimony in sensitive investigations. What level of cooperation should be expected from former public servants when facing inquiries into past associations?

The legal complexities surrounding compelled testimony are significant. While Congress has broad subpoena power, it is not unlimited. Individuals can assert various privileges, including the Fifth Amendment right against self-incrimination and attorney-client privilege. The committee will likely face legal challenges if it attempts to force the Clintons to testify against their will.
